ZIP 22042 and ZIP 22044 are ZIP Code areas in Virginia.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 22042 has the higher population (34,631 vs 14,001 in ZIP 22044). ZIP 22042 has the higher median household income ($135,578 vs $100,129 in ZIP 22044). ZIP 22044 has the higher median home value ($711,400 vs $666,700 in ZIP 22042).
